The global Cobalt Alloys Market continues to demonstrate steady growth, with its valuation reaching USD 295 million in 2024. According to the latest industry analysis, the market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 3.1%, reaching approximately USD 365 million by 2032. This growth is largely fueled by increasing applications in aerospace, energy, and medical sectors, particularly in regions with advanced manufacturing capabilities where demand for high-performance, heat-resistant, and corrosion-resistant materials continues to rise.
Cobalt alloys are integral to the production of turbine blades, orthopedic implants, and wear-resistant components. Their exceptional strength and durability make them highly desirable in industries requiring materials that perform under extreme conditions. Market Overview & Regional Analysis
North America dominates the global cobalt alloys market with a 37% revenue share, driven by strong consumption in the United States and Canada. The region benefits from robust aerospace manufacturing, defense investments, and advanced R&D in high-temperature materials, fueling demand for superalloys in jet engines and power generation equipment.
Europe’s growth is bolstered by stringent performance standards and increasing investments in medical technologies. Asia-Pacific leads in rapid industrialization, with significant production in China and Japan, supported by expanding energy infrastructure. Emerging regions like South America and the Middle East & Africa show promising growth potential, despite supply chain and geopolitical challenges.
Key Market Drivers and Opportunities
The market is driven by the expansion of the aerospace industry, rising demand in power generation for gas turbines, and technological advancements in biomedical applications. Aerospace accounts for 57% of global demand, followed by energy at around 20% and medical at 12%. New applications in additive manufacturing and renewable energy components offer significant future opportunities.
Opportunities also lie in the development of recycled cobalt alloys and the integration of these materials in hydrogen production systems. The Asian energy market and European medical device sector present untapped potential for exporters.
Challenges & Restraints
The cobalt alloys market faces challenges including raw material price volatility, ethical sourcing concerns, and rising environmental regulations. Supply disruptions from key mining regions continue to impact global availability, while high compliance costs limit scalability for smaller producers. Geopolitical tensions, such as those affecting cobalt exports from Africa, pose further risks.
